Ragin' Cajuns Hold Annual Pro Day Workouts

3/25/2015 7:58:00 PM | Football

Representatives from 31 NFL teams on hand to look at Ragin' Cajuns

LAFAYETTE – Representatives from 31 NFL teams spent much of the day at the Leon Moncla Indoor Facility on Wednesday as the Louisiana Ragin' Cajuns football team hosted its annual Pro Day workouts.
 
Fifteen members of the Ragin' Cajuns 2013-14 team were tested in the vertical and broad jumps, the 225-pound bench press, the 40-yard dash and various shuttle runs during the afternoon workout in preparation for next month's NFL Draft.
 
Among the Louisiana players to work out included: quarterback Terrance Broadway, running back Alonzo Harris, wide receiver James Butler, tight end Larry Pettis, offensive linemen Terry Johnson, Jarad Martin and Daniel Quave, linebacker Boris Anyama, defensive lineman Justin Hamilton, Marvin Martin and Christian Ringo, and defensive backs Sean Thomas and Corey Trim. Former Ragin' Cajuns Ian Thompson and Brandon McCray were also tested in various drills.
 
Many of the participants who went through workouts on Wednesday spent much of their time in Lafayette after the 2014 season working with the Louisiana strength and conditioning staff, led by Rusty Whitt.
 
Louisiana, which finished 9-4 last season and captured its fourth consecutive R+L Carriers New Orleans Bowl title, will return to spring practice on Thursday at 3:45 p.m. before holding its annual Red-White Spring Game on Saturday at 5 p.m. at Cajun Field.
